EDITORS COMMENTS
Sir Thomas Lawrence (1769-1830), a renowned British portrait painter of the Regency period, is captured in this enchanting image as a young boy. The photograph, taken around the year of his birth, offers a rare glimpse into the early life of this artistic prodigy. Born on April 13, 1769, in Bristol, England, Lawrence showed an early aptitude for art. He was apprenticed to a local portrait painter at the age of 14, and by 1787, he had moved to London to study under the renowned artist Joshua Reynolds. Reynolds recognized Lawrence's talent and encouraged him to focus on portrait painting. Lawrence's early years were marked by hard work and dedication to his craft. He spent countless hours perfecting his technique and building a reputation as a skilled artist. By the time he was in his late twenties, he had become a popular and successful portrait painter, with a clientele that included members of the British royal family and the aristocracy.
